Role Description
Quantum Cryptography Engineer Develops and implements secure communication systems using quantum mechanics. High demand, excellent growth potential.
Quantum Security Analyst Assesses and mitigates risks associated with quantum computing on current cryptographic systems. Strong analytical skills needed.
Quantum Cryptography Researcher Conducts research to advance the field of quantum cryptography, pushing the boundaries of secure communication. PhD preferred.
Quantum Key Distribution (QKD) Specialist Focuses on the practical implementation and management of QKD systems, ensuring secure key exchange. Growing field.
Post-Quantum Cryptography Specialist Works on algorithms resistant to attacks from both classical and quantum computers. Future-proof career.
